Hi Hackers,

While reviewing [1], it makes me recall an experience where I had a patch
ready locally, but CommitFest CI failed with a shadows-variable warning.
Now I understand that -Wall doesn't by default enable -Wshadows with some
compilers like clang.

I did a clean build with manually enabling -Wshadow and surprisingly found
there are a lot of such warnings in the current code base, roughly ~200
occurrences.

As there are too many, I plan to fix them all in 3-4 rounds. For round 1
patch, I'd see any objection, then decide if to proceed more rounds.
